NetComm Wireless signs deal to sell NBN technology to AT&T
2015-11-25 02:31:51| Wireless - Topix.net
Little-known Australian technology company, NetComm Wireless, has signed a deal to help supply NBN-like wireless broadband networks for a major US telecommunications provider, believed to be AT&T. NetComm is a locally-listed company with a market capitalisation of $129 million that is best known for its wireless routers and modems - a market that has been badly hurt by the falling cost of devices.

NBN satellite 'Sky Muster' launched successfully
2015-10-01 15:14:00| Telecompaper Headlines
(Telecompaper) NBN Co and aerospace contractors have successfully launched Sky Muster satellites from the Guiana Space Centre in French Guiana. The NBN satellites will deliver fast broadband to rural and remote Australians. The satellites will provide speeds of 25 Mbps download and 5 Mbps upload. They will operate in the Ka Band frequency of 26.540 GHz wavelengths on the electromagnetic spectrum, allowing higher bandwidth communication.
